The four characteristics that uniquely identify the Roman Catholic Church as the one true Church. We profess them in the Nicene Creed at Mass each Sunday.
What are the Four Marks of the Church?
God making Himself known throughout human history through His words and deeds.
What is Divine Revelation?

The mystery of Christ becoming man.
What is the Incarnation?
The power whereby Jesus was conceived in the womb of the Blessed Virgin Mary.
What is the Holy Spirit?
The belief that the Catholic Church was founded by Jesus on the Apostles and that it continues to be led by her successors, the Pope and Bishops to this very day.
What is Apostolic Succession?
A gift that helps us to believe in God and all that He has revealed to us.
What is Faith?
The Creed that we recite AT MASS each Sunday.
What is the Nicene Creed?
Jesus's return in glory to Heaven, where He is seated at the right hand of God the Father.
What is the Ascension?
Those honored by the Church for their exceptional contributions to our understanding of Faith or Doctrine.
Who are "Doctors of the Church"?
The gift of the Holy Spirit whereby the Pope and all the Bishops in union with him can teach on matters of Faith and morals without error.
What is "infallibility" (or "Papal Infallibility")?
The transmission of the Gospel message as lived out by the Church, past and present.
What is Sacred Tradition?
A sacred agreement that establishes a relationship between God and his people.
What is a Covenant?

The day the Holy Spirit descended from Heaven on Mary and the Apostles, 50 days after the Resurrection (Easter Sunday).
What is Pentecost?
The mark of the Church that indicates she contains all the Truths necessary for salvation and has a mission to all peoples worldwide.
What is "Catholic"?
New Testament letters written to the early Christian communities or their leaders, often authored by Saint Paul.
What are epistles?
The Summa Theologiae is the greatest theological work of this Catholic Saint and Doctor of the Church.
Who is Saint Thomas Aquinas?
